logo

Output 0421ba16bc4af9055ac7aa9eb303f6b09bed07552b822e6e12e663857f7c003f:1

value
18678000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edd58dcbdb35d9e8dec78093d813daa582f6d25a OP_EQUAL
address
3PNZtzVfZWEpTvnSUpT54mMap3d58xvhp5
transaction
0421ba16bc4af9055ac7aa9eb303f6b09bed07552b822e6e12e663857f7c003f